Britisch cinema and Thatcherism is an informed and provocative Analysis of the Responses of British film to the policies and political ideology of the Conservative governments of Margaret Thatcher. It is the first up-to-date examination of British film of the 1980s, and it represents an original and stimulating contribution to our knowledge of British cinema. Films during the Thatcher era bear Little resemblance to the tasteful but tedious adaptions so often associated with British film-making, and instead Show a varying degree of reaction to Thatcherite ideology.
